Beef, Spinach and Egg Scramble
Low Carb Recipe
Beef, Spinach and Egg Scramble with spinach adding a nice nutritional kick to this main dish of ground beef with garlic, basil and red pepper sauce served with scrambled eggs.
Ingredients
1 teaspoon olive oil
1 small onion, chopped
1 pound lean ground beef
1 clove garlic, minced
10 ounces frozen chopped spinach, thawed and squeezed dry
4 eggs
1/2 teaspoon basil
1/4 teaspoon hot red pepper sauce
2 tablespoons grated Parmesan cheese
Recipe Directions
Heat oil in a heavy nonstick skillet over medium high heat. Saute onion about 3 minutes, stirring often, until softened. Add ground beef and garlic. Cook 5 minutes, stirring often to break up meat, until browned. Add spinach and cook 1 minute, stirring often.
Reduce heat to medium. Beat eggs, basil, hot sauce and salt and pepper to taste in a medium bowl. Add egg mixture to skillet and cook about 1 minute, stirring often, until eggs are set. Sprinkle cheese over top and serve immediately.

Nutrition Information
Yield: 4 Servings
Calories: 310;
Fat: 16.6g;
Cholesterol: 230mg;
Protein: 32.3g;
Carbohydrate: 7.4g;
Fiber: 3g;
Sodium: 224mg
Exchanges: 1-1/2 Vegetable, 4.2 Lean Meat, 1 Fat
